摘要:在12月,实现Java实时监控步骤,旨在提高系统监控与管理效率。通过搭建实时监控平台,对Java应用程序进行实时性能监控,包括资源占用、内存使用、线程状态等关键指标。借助相关工具和框架,实现自动化监控和报警机制,确保系统稳定运行。通过实时监控,及时发现并解决潜在问题,提高系统性能和响应速度,确保高效系统监控与管理。
前言:
随着信息技术的飞速发展,Java在企业级应用中的普及率越来越高,为了确保Java应用程序的稳定运行,实时监控和管理变得尤为重要,本文将详细介绍在12月内如何实施Java实时监控步骤,帮助您实现高效的系统监控与管理,确保应用程序的顺畅运行,让我们深入了解这一过程,掌握关键技巧,优化您的IT环境。
一、确定监控目标
在进行Java实时监控之前,首先需要明确监控的目标,这包括但不限于:应用程序性能、内存使用情况、线程状态以及潜在的错误和异常等,明确目标有助于我们更有针对性地制定监控策略。
二、选择合适的监控工具
选择合适的Java监控工具是实施实时监控的关键步骤,市场上存在许多优秀的Java监控工具,如JVisualVM、JConsole等,这些工具可以帮助我们实时查看Java应用程序的性能指标,发现潜在问题并采取相应措施。
三、配置与部署
配置和部署监控工具是实施Java实时监控的重要步骤,在这一阶段,我们需要根据实际需求配置监控参数,确保能够收集到关键信息,要确保监控工具的部署不会影响到应用程序的正常运行。
四、实施监控步骤
1、系统资源监控:实时监控系统的CPU、内存、磁盘和网络资源使用情况,确保系统资源得到合理分配。
2、Java应用程序性能监控:关注应用程序的响应时间、吞吐量、并发量等关键指标,确保应用程序性能稳定。
3、日志分析:定期分析应用程序日志,发现潜在的问题和异常,及时调整监控策略。
4、线程监控与分析:关注Java应用程序的线程状态,及时发现并处理线程问题,避免死锁和性能瓶颈。
5、内存管理监控:实时监控Java应用程序的内存使用情况,确保内存得到有效管理,避免内存泄漏和溢出问题。
五、案例分析
为了更好地理解Java实时监控的实施过程,我们来看一个案例分析,某大型电商网站在高峰期间遇到了性能瓶颈,通过实施Java实时监控,发现内存使用异常和线程阻塞问题,通过调整JVM参数和优化代码,成功解决了性能问题,确保了网站在高峰期间的稳定运行。
六、持续优化与调整
实施Java实时监控后,我们需要根据收集到的数据和信息持续优化和调整监控策略,这包括定期分析监控数据、调整监控参数、优化系统资源配置等,通过持续优化和调整,我们可以确保Java应用程序的稳定运行,提高系统的整体性能。
七、总结与展望
本文详细介绍了12月Java实时监控的步骤,包括确定监控目标、选择合适的监控工具、配置与部署、实施监控步骤、案例分析以及持续优化与调整等方面,通过实施Java实时监控,我们可以实现高效的系统监控与管理,确保Java应用程序的稳定运行,随着技术的不断发展,我们将继续探索更先进的监控技术,为企业的IT环境提供更加稳定和高效的支持。
转载请注明来自溜溜的小站,本文标题:《12月Java实时监控步骤,实现高效系统监控与管理》
还没有评论,来说两句吧...